분류 전체보기142 [XML ] XML 구성 요소 XML for Beginners John Doe XYZ Publishing 2023 39.99 Programming true , &, and " are used freely here without any issues. ]]> :XML 문서의 선언부입니다. version="1.0"은 XML의 버전을, encoding="UTF-8"은 문서의 문자 인코딩 방식을 나타냅니다.루트 요소 :이 XML 문서에서 루트 요소는 입니다. 이 요소는 여러 개의 요소를 포함.. 2025. 3. 19. [초롱] 전기장판 내꺼 2025. 2. 25. [동적 컴파일] 자바 동적 컴파일러 public class DynamicCompiler { public static void main(String[] args) { String sourceCode = "public class HelloWorld {" + " public void sayHello() {" + " System.out.println(\"Hello, World!\");" + // 누락된 세미콜론 추가 " }" + "}"; try { // 컴파일된 클래스를 메모리에 저장하기 위한 임시 경로 File tempDir = new File(System... 2024. 12. 18. [Web] Listener, Filter 의 차이점 Listener와 Filter는 Java 웹 애플리케이션에서 각각 다른 역할을 합니다. 이 둘은 요청과 응답 흐름에 개입할 수 있지만, 적용되는 방식과 목적이 다릅니다. 아래에서 두 가지의 차이점을 정리해 보겠습니다.1. ListenerListener는 애플리케이션의 생명주기 및 특정 이벤트를 모니터링하고 처리하는 데 사용됩니다.특징:목적: 웹 애플리케이션의 상태나 이벤트(요청, 세션 생성/종료 등)를 감지하고 필요한 작업 수행.적용 범위: 전체 애플리케이션의 특정 이벤트 감지.주요 인터페이스:ServletContextListener → 애플리케이션 시작/종료 이벤트 처리.HttpSessionListener → 세션 생성/소멸 이벤트 처리.ServletRequestListener → 요청 생성/소멸 이벤.. 2024. 12. 4. [Web] Request, Session, Aplication 등 적용 범위 범위 요약 비교범위데이터 접근 가능성유지 기간주요 용도Request현재 HTTP 요청 동안요청 완료 시 소멸임시 데이터 처리Session특정 사용자에 한정세션 만료 또는 로그아웃 시 소멸사용자별 상태 관리Application모든 사용자와 모든 요청에서 공유애플리케이션 종료 시 소멸전역 데이터 관리Cookie클라이언트 장치에 저장브라우저 종료 또는 만료 시 소멸지속적인 상태 관리실제 사용 예시Request: 폼 데이터를 서버에서 처리.Session: 로그인한 사용자의 프로필 정보 유지.Application: 데이터베이스 연결 풀과 같은 전역 리소스 저장.Cookie: 로그인 상태 유지(자동 로그인). 2024. 12. 3. [Content-Type] Content-Type 종류 주요 Content-Type 종류다음은 일반적으로 사용되는 MIME 타입과 그 용도입니다.1. 텍스트 데이터text/plain: 단순 텍스트 데이터 (ASCII 또는 UTF-8 인코딩)text/html: HTML 문서text/css: CSS 스타일시트text/javascript: JavaScript 파일 (구형 브라우저 호환)text/csv: CSV 파일2. 애플리케이션 데이터application/json: JSON 데이터application/xml: XML 데이터application/pdf: PDF 문서application/zip: ZIP 압축 파일application/vnd.ms-excel: Microsoft Excel 파일application/octet-stream: 임의의 바이너리 데이터 (파일 .. 2024. 12. 3. 이전 1 2 3 4 5 ··· 24 다음